Output 03e80198765767dc0fa7f808c3615231c2fc3d3c4eaa23482bd39e4fa7c5fa1c: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71baee10738bc09162fd64cc9a15eba54079f600 OP_EQUAL
address
3C4NDLhR8ctRBxWvcTScKYWikQ6ZSUjR3b
transaction
03e80198765767dc0fa7f808c3615231c2fc3d3c4eaa23482bd39e4fa7c5fa1c
confirmations
266899
spent
true